Secret Features to Consider When Purchasing a Treadmill
When thinking about which treadmill suits your needs best, several factors enter into play:
- Motor Power: Measured in horse power (HP), a treadmill with at least 2.5 HP is ideal for running.
- Running Surface Area: A larger surface provides more convenience and safety, especially for taller users.
- Incline Options: An adjustable slope assists simulate uphill running, enhancing exercise strength.
- Foldability and Storage: Space-saving styles with folding mechanisms are more effective for those with limited space.
- Cushioning Technology: Good cushioning lowers effect on joints and ensures a comfy run.
- Display Features: Look for a clear display screen that reveals vital workout metrics.
Top Home Treadmills in the UK
1. NordicTrack Commercial 1750
The NordicTrack Commercial 1750 is one of the most advanced treadmills offered. It boasts an effective 3.75 CHP motor, a roomy 22" x 60" running surface area, and a maximum incline of 15%. The integrated touchscreen display screen supports HD exercises and iFit innovation.
Key Specifications:
Feature | Requirements |
---|---|
Motor | 3.75 CHP |
Running Surface | 22" x 60" |
Maximum Speed | 12 mph |
Incline/Decline | -3% to 15% |
Weight Capacity | 135 kg |
2. ProForm Pro 2000
An outstanding option for home users, the ProForm Pro 2000 is equipped with a 3.5 CHP motor and a cushioning system that lessens impact on the joints. Its 10-inch touchscreen provides access to interactive exercises by means of iFit.
Key Specifications:
Feature | Spec |
---|---|
Motor | 3.5 CHP |
Running Surface | 20" x 60" |
Maximum Speed | 12 miles per hour |
Incline/Decline | -3% to 15% |
Weight Capacity | 135 kg |
3. Horizon T202
The Horizon T202 treadmill integrates price with performance. It includes a 2.5 CHP motor and a compact style, perfect for smaller sized spaces. This model supplies many exercise programs and is simple to assemble.
Key Specifications:
Feature | Spec |
---|---|
Motor | 2.5 CHP |
Running Surface | 20" x 55" |
Maximum Speed | 10 mph |
Slope | 0 to 10% |
Weight Capacity | 136 kg |
4. Tekneco Folding Treadmill
An extremely space-efficient alternative, the Tekneco Folding Treadmill is best for home users with limited room. It offers a solid 2.0 HP motor and an optimum speed of 10 km/h. Its collapsible style makes it simple to save away after workouts.
Key Specifications:
Feature | Requirements |
---|---|
Motor | 2.0 HP |
Running Surface | 15.5" x 40" |
Maximum Speed | 10 km/h |
Slope | No slope |
Weight Capacity | 100 kg |
5. Sole F63
The Sole F63 treadmill is renowned for its toughness and performance. With a 3.0 CHP motor and a remarkable service warranty, it appropriates for both novices and more serious runners.
Secret Specifications:
Feature | Spec |
---|---|
Motor | 3.0 CHP |
Running Surface | 20" x 60" |
Maximum Speed | 12 mph |
Incline | 0 to 15% |
Weight Capacity | 136 kg |
FAQs: Best Home Treadmills
1. Are treadmills easy to assemble?
A lot of contemporary treadmills included comprehensive user's manual, making assembly uncomplicated. Lots of producers also provide client service support to help with the setup.
2. Just how much area do I need for a treadmill?
While it varies by model, you need to plan for a minimum of a 2-meter by 1-meter space for most treadmills. Think about both the footprint when in usage and the extra space needed for folding.
3. What is the average life expectancy of a treadmill?
A well-maintained treadmill can last anywhere from 7 to 12 years. Routine maintenance, including lubrication and keeping the machine clean, improves its durability.
4. Can I utilize a treadmill for walking instead of running?
Definitely! Treadmills are fantastic for walking, and many settings enable for a low-impact workout option, making them appropriate for users of all fitness levels.

5. What is the weight limitation on most home treadmills?
Weight limits normally range from 100 kg to 180 kg. It's important to check the specs for the model you plan to buy to ensure it meets your requirements.
